Shooty + mobility. The two elements you need to specialise in in order to win against Daemons.
Shooty:
As most people have said, get as many heavy bolters, and assault cannons possible. When Daemons Deep Strike in, you have one turn to wipe the table clean before they can deal some damage. The occassional flamer to thin hords that get too close is a good idea.
Mobility:
Deamons Dees Strike in your face, regardless. If all of your units can move 12" away and still bring all of their fire power to bear, they will not touch you as they are mostly infantry and cant move all that fast.
In terms of your list, Null Zone is awesome. Keep it.
Drop the terminators, not likely to survive combat with a 5+ invuln against squads with power weapons.
Advise Land Speeders with Heavy Bolters and Assault Cannons.
Give your tactical squads rhinos. You want to be able to move faster, out of the way of deamon nasties. Drop Pods give you nothing once you have landed.
Preds are solid choices.

Where does the Librarian go? I see two 10 man squads in Rhinos, unless you plan to combat squad to shoot Lascannons (I recommend against this).
Here is the list I would not want to see with my Daemons.
Librarian - Null Zone (Gate works, any other power)
10x Space Marines - Flamer, Missile Launcher Razorback w/ LasPlas
10x Space Marines - Flamer, Missile Launcher, Razorback w/ LasPlas
2x Dakka Predators
Fill in the rest as appropriate - Daemons die to a large number of anti-infantry shots. Against them Quantity has a Quality of its own. Use your vehicles to block off assaults and stay in relatively open ground to deny them cover. When needed, dart up and dump out your Flamer units to focus fire down the remnants of the opponents force.
Remember if he is close enough to assault next turn, he should be in range of Null Zone.
